College Identity Graphics


Usage
: In most cases, the logo (which includes BOTH the mark and text) should be used to identify the College. See the Arts & Sciences Style Guide for more information. If you would like to use these graphics in another way, or have other questions, contact Marilyn Kliman (6-3506).

Instructions: To retrieve a graphic, right click on "download" and then select SAVE TARGET AS. Select the directory on your machine where you would like to save the file.
